What Features Should the Best VR Headset for Cyberpunk 2077 Have?
The best VR headset for Cyberpunk 2077 should have several key features to enhance the immersive gameplay experience.
- High Resolution: A headset with high resolution (at least 1080p per eye) is essential for the detailed graphics of Cyberpunk 2077. This ensures that the stunning visuals and intricate environments of Night City are displayed clearly, minimizing the screen-door effect that can disrupt immersion.
- Wide Field of View: A wider field of view (FOV) allows players to take in more of their surroundings, making the experience feel more natural and immersive. A FOV of at least 100 degrees can help players engage more fully with the vibrant world and fast-paced action of the game.
- Low Latency: Low latency is crucial for a responsive gaming experience, especially in fast-paced scenarios. Headsets with lower latency reduce motion sickness and provide a smoother, more enjoyable gameplay experience as players navigate through the bustling streets of Cyberpunk 2077.
- Comfortable Fit: Since players may spend hours in VR, a comfortable fit with adjustable straps and cushioning is important. A well-fitted headset minimizes fatigue and allows players to focus on the game without discomfort, enhancing the overall enjoyment of exploring the game’s rich narrative.
- Good Tracking: Accurate tracking technology, such as inside-out or external sensors, is vital for precise movements. This feature allows players to interact with the game world seamlessly, whether they’re aiming a weapon or navigating through complex environments, making gameplay more intuitive.
- Integrated Audio: High-quality integrated audio or compatibility with external audio solutions can significantly enhance immersion. Spatial audio helps players locate sounds accurately within the game world, contributing to a more realistic and engaging experience as they explore the streets of Night City.
- Compatible Controllers: Headsets that come with or are compatible with advanced motion controllers offer a more interactive experience. These controllers allow for natural hand movements and gestures, making combat and exploration in Cyberpunk 2077 feel more engaging and intuitive.

Why Is Resolution Important for Immersive VR Experiences in Cyberpunk 2077?
Resolution is critical for immersive VR experiences in Cyberpunk 2077 because it directly affects the clarity and detail of the virtual environment, which in turn enhances user engagement and realism.
According to a study by the Virtual Reality Developers Association, higher resolution in VR headsets significantly improves the user’s perception of presence and immersion, making the virtual world feel more lifelike (VRDA, 2021). The visual fidelity provided by high resolution allows players to notice intricate details in the game’s dense urban environments, fostering a deeper connection to the game’s narrative and aesthetics.
The underlying mechanism involves how the human visual system processes visual information. When a VR headset has a lower resolution, it can lead to pixelation and a visible screen door effect, which detracts from the immersive experience. This phenomenon can cause discomfort and reduce the sense of presence, as users become more aware of the technology rather than the virtual world. Conversely, a headset with higher resolution minimizes these issues, allowing for smoother graphics and a more engaging experience, which is particularly important in a visually rich game like Cyberpunk 2077 where the environment is packed with details and dynamic elements.

What Are the Price Ranges for the Best VR Headsets for Cyberpunk 2077?
The price ranges for the best VR headsets suitable for playing Cyberpunk 2077 vary significantly based on features and performance.
- Oculus Quest 2: This standalone headset typically ranges from $299 to $399, depending on storage options.
- Valve Index: Priced around $999, this high-end system offers exceptional performance and a premium experience.
- HTC Vive Pro 2: The headset alone costs approximately $799, while a full kit with base stations and controllers can reach up to $1,399.
- Pimax 8K X: This ultra-wide headset is priced around $1,299, catering to enthusiasts looking for high resolution and a wider field of view.
- HP Reverb G2: With a price range of $599, this headset is known for its high-resolution display and comfort.

What Are the Overall Recommendations for the Best VR Headsets for Playing Cyberpunk 2077?
The best VR headsets for playing Cyberpunk 2077 offer high resolution, comfort, and immersive experiences to enhance gameplay.
- Valve Index: Known for its high refresh rate and excellent tracking, the Valve Index provides a truly immersive experience. Its dual 1440×1600 LCDs deliver sharp visuals, while the finger-tracking controllers enhance interaction with the game’s environment.
- Oculus Quest 2: The Oculus Quest 2 is a versatile standalone headset that can also connect to a PC for enhanced graphics. With a resolution of 1832×1920 per eye, it offers a great visual experience, and its wireless capability allows for free movement while exploring Night City.
- HTC Vive Pro 2: The HTC Vive Pro 2 features one of the highest resolutions in the market at 2448×2448 per eye, making it perfect for detailed graphics in Cyberpunk 2077. Its comfortable design and high-quality audio system also contribute to an immersive gaming experience.
- Pimax 8K X: This headset boasts an impressive 4K per eye resolution, making it one of the best choices for visual fidelity in VR gaming. The wide field of view enhances immersion, allowing players to feel truly present in the expansive world of Cyberpunk 2077.
